Stadium Info

Target Field

Target Field is known for its modern amenities and fantastic viewing experience.

  • Address: 1 Twins Way, Minneapolis, MN 55403

  • Capacity: 38,544

  • Features: Extensive concessions, multiple video boards, fan zones, and excellent accessibility.

  • Accessibility: The stadium offers accessible seating, elevators, ramps, and services for fans with disabilities. Wheelchair escorts and assistive listening devices are available upon request.

FAQs for Minnesota Twins Fans
  • How do I buy tickets for Minnesota Twins games? Purchase directly from the team’s official website or trusted secondary ticket sites.

  • What are the best seats at Target Field? Club Level seats, Dugout Box, and Field Box provide the best views.

  • Can I bring food and drinks into the stadium? Outside food and beverages are generally not allowed, but there are plenty of concessions inside.

  • What time do gates open for games? Gates typically open two hours before the first pitch.

  • How can I get to the stadium by public transport? Use the METRO Blue and Green Lines or buses for convenient access to the stadium.
